Питхон

Питхон Иф Елсе изјава

Питхон Иф Елсе изјава
Питхон иф-елсе изјава користи се у коду за доношење одлука. Чешће је потребно доношење одлуке за извршавање одређеног дела кода ако је одређени услов тачан.

У Питхону је сврха коришћења иф-елсе доношење одлука. Синтакса наредбе иф-елсе у Питхону слична је већини програмских језика као што су Јава, Ц, Ц ++ и Ц #.

Овај чланак детаљно описује Питхон иф-елсе изјаве.

Синтакса

иф тест_екпрессион:
изјава (е) за извршење
иначе:
изјава (е) за извршење

У услову иф процењује се израз теста. Тест израз се може назвати и условом. У случају истинитог стања, извршава се израз иф блока, у супротном се програмски ток преноси у увјет елсе. Дијаграм тока приказује извршење наредбе иф-елсе.

Примери изјава Питхон иф елсе

Погледајмо пример иф-елсе у Питхону. У наведеном примеру, нум променљива је декларисана за број са вредношћу 13. Ако услов проверава да ли је број већи од 10 или не. Ако је вредност броја већа од 10, тада се извршава тело блока иф и исписује да је број већи од 10. У случају да је број мањи од 10, тада се извршава блок елсе и исписује да је број мањи од 10.

нум = 13
# примена услова
ако је број> 10:
принт ("Број је већи од 10")
# декларација изјаве елсе
иначе:
принт ("Број је мањи од 10")

Оутпут
Излаз показује да је број 13 већи од 10.


Сада, да видимо пример броја који је мањи од 10.

нум = 3
# декларација изјаве иф да би се проверило да ли је број већи од 10 или не
ако је број> 10:
принт ("Број је већи од 10")
иначе:
принт ("Број је мањи од 10")

Оутпут

Изјава елиф у Питхону

Питхон нам омогућава да проценимо или проверимо вишеструке изразе теста помоћу израза елиф. Елиф је кратки образац за изјаву елсе иф. Помоћу математичких оператора можемо проценити стање попут =, != (није једнако), <, >, итд.

У елиф изјави, ако први иф услов није тачан, програм ће проценити следеће стање елиф блока и тако даље. У случају да су сви услови нетачни, тада ће се коначно извршити преостали услов.

Погледајмо пример овога.

# проглашавање променљиве имена
наме = инпут ("Унесите име животиње \ н")
ако је име == "крава":
принт ("Уписали сте краву")
елиф наме == "пас":
принт ("Ушли сте у пса")
елиф наме == "мачка":
принт ("Ушли сте у мачку")
иначе:
принт ("Ово је блок елсе")

Оутпут

Угњежено иф стање у Питхон-у

Можемо пријавити вишеструке иф услове унутар иф услова. Ова појава назива се угнеждени услов. Да видимо пример за то.

# проглашавање старосне променљиве
старост = 13
ако је старост> 10:
принт ("Ви сте изнад 10")
# ан услов унутар услова иф
ако је старост> 12:
принт ("Такође сте изнад 12")
ако је старост == 13:
принт ("Имате 13 година")
иначе:
принт ("Немате 13 година")
иначе:
принт ("Имате мање од 10 година")

Оутпут

Закључак

Овај чланак објашњава иф-елсе изјаву у Питхону користећи једноставне примере. Наредба иф-елсе користи се за процену израза теста.

Како преузети и играти Сид Меиер'с Цивилизатион ВИ на Линук-у
Увод у игру Цивилизатион 6 је модерни поглед на класични концепт представљен у серији игара Аге оф Емпирес. Идеја је била прилично једноставна; започе...
Како инсталирати и играти Доом на Линук-у
Увод у Доом Доом серија настала је 90-их година након објављивања оригиналног Доом-а. То је био тренутни хит и од тог времена надаље серија игара је д...
Вулкан за кориснике Линука
Са сваком новом генерацијом графичких картица видимо да програмери игара помичу границе графичке верности и долазе на корак од фотореализма. Али упрко...